net.minecraft.world.level

public record SpawnData

chn
net.minecraft.world.level.SpawnData
net.minecraft.class_1952
net.minecraft.unmapped.C_edcjbljn
net.minecraft.world.MobSpawnerEntry
net.minecraft.world.MobSpawnerEntry
net.minecraft.src.C_1620_
net.minecraft.world.level.MobSpawnerData

Field summary

Modifier and TypeField
private final CompoundTag
d
entityToSpawn
comp_64
f_fwsalxge
entity
entityToSpawn
f_186561_
private final Optional<SpawnData$CustomSpawnRules>
e
customSpawnRules
comp_65
f_swncnqkj
customSpawnRules
customSpawnRules
f_186562_
public static final com.mojang.serialization.Codec<SpawnData>
a
CODEC
field_34460
f_ilsksuse
CODEC
CODEC
f_186559_
public static final com.mojang.serialization.Codec<SimpleWeightedRandomList<SpawnData>>
b
LIST_CODEC
field_34461
f_kquvrajh
DATA_POOL_CODEC
DATA_POOL_CODEC
f_186560_
public static final String
c
DEFAULT_TYPE
field_30977
f_xumslcvz
DEFAULT_ENTITY_ID
DEFAULT_ENTITY_ID
f_151630_

Constructor summary

ModifierConstructor
public ()
public (CompoundTag f_186562_, Optional<SpawnData$CustomSpawnRules> arg1)

Method summary

Modifier and TypeMethod
public CompoundTag
a()
getEntityToSpawn()
method_38093()
m_upcwhsjp()
getNbt()
getEntityToSpawn()
m_186567_()
public Optional<SpawnData$CustomSpawnRules>
b()
getCustomSpawnRules()
method_38097()
m_hnvblbtt()
getCustomSpawnRules()
getCustomSpawnRules()
m_186574_()
public CompoundTag
c()
entityToSpawn()
comp_64()
m_hzqmtgsf()
entity()
entityToSpawn()
f_186561_()
public Optional<SpawnData$CustomSpawnRules>
d()
customSpawnRules()
comp_65()
m_ulnjbjev()
customSpawnRules()
customSpawnRules()
f_186562_()